Transaction 104852695e60c7e71f7bc15cae46b6e0e56e4c0cf1b52fccbf903e1b6ce2b276

1 Input
2 Outputs
  • 104852695e60c7e71f7bc15cae46b6e0e56e4c0cf1b52fccbf903e1b6ce2b276:0
  • value  31311
    address  32RJstEYTRNjAJ3n546Tv4KT6EScQQmC1a
  • 104852695e60c7e71f7bc15cae46b6e0e56e4c0cf1b52fccbf903e1b6ce2b276:1
  • value  23785015
    address  1LFgbJ6KpymhyMWqyjHXMH7gB5ZRojYrnE